On Thee my heart is resting, Ah, this is rest indeed: What else, Almighty Savior, Can a poor sinner need? Thy light is all my wisdom, Thy love is all my stay; Thy coming back in glory, Draws nearer every day. |
On Thee my heart is resting, Ah, this is rest indeed: What else, Almighty Savior, Can a poor sinner need? |
2 |
My guilt is great, but greater The mercy Thou dost give; Thyself, a spotless Off'ring, Hast died that I should live. With Thee, my soul unfettered Has risen from the dust; Thy blood is all my treasure, Thy word is all my trust. |
On Thee my heart is resting, Ah, this is rest indeed: What else, Almighty Savior, Can a poor sinner need? |
3 |
Through me, Thou gentle Master, Thy purposes fulfil; I yield myself forever To Thy most holy will. What though I be but weakness? My strength is not in me; The poorest of Thy people Has all things, having Thee. |
On Thee my heart is resting, Ah, this is rest indeed: What else, Almighty Savior, Can a poor sinner need? |
4 |
When clouds are darkest round me, Thou, Lord, art then most near, My drooping faith to quicken, My weary soul to cheer. Safe nestling in Thy bosom, I gaze upon Thy face; In vain my foes would drive me From Thee, my hiding-place. |
On Thee my heart is resting, Ah, this is rest indeed: What else, Almighty Savior, Can a poor sinner need? |
5 |
'Tis Thou hast made me happy, 'Tis Thou hast set me free; To whom shall I give glory Forever, but to Thee? Of earthly love and blessing Should every stream run dry, Thy grace shall still be with me, Thy grace, to live and die. |
On Thee my heart is resting, Ah, this is rest indeed: What else, Almighty Savior, Can a poor sinner need? |
